Pendant Crown Ethers 운반체를 이용한 에멀젼 액체막계에서의 Pb^2+ 분리
이종광,이부영,김종향,조문환 慶尙大學校 기초과학연구소 1992 基礎科學硏究所報 Vol.8 No.-
Acryloyl methyl benzo-18-crown-6 단위체는 '4-hydroxymethyl benzo-18-crown-6와 acryloyl chloride을 반응시켜 합성하였다. Poly(acryloyl methyl benzo-18-crown-6)는 벤젠용매하에서 AIBN을 개시제로하여 제조하였다. [0.001mole/L M(NO_3)_n(M^2+ =Na^+, Mg^2+, Ca^2+, Sr^2+, Ba^2+, Zn^2+, Cu^2+, Cd^2+, Mn^n+ 와 Pb^2+)]를 포함한 source phase와 거대고리 리간드 [acryloyl methyl benzo-18-crown-6와 poly(acryloyl methyl benzo-18-crown-6)]와 계면활성제 Span 80을 포함한 toluene 막 그리고 Li_4P_2O_7를 포함하는 receiving phase로 구성되어진 에멀젼 액체막계에서 source phase로 부터 금속이온들의 소멸속도를 연구하였다. 금속이온의 이동에 관한 실험에서, 각 혼합물로 부터 Pb^2+ 이온이 가장 높은 이동율을 나타내었다. Acryloyl methyl benzo-18-crown-6 was synthesized by reacting 4'-hydroxymethyl benzo-18-crown-6 with acryloyl chloride. Poly(acryolyl methyl benzo-18-crown-6) was prepared in benzene by using AIBN as an initiator. The disapperance of metal ions from source phase as a function of time was studied in emulsion liquid membrane systems comprised in an aqueous source phase [0.001mole/L M(NO_3)_n(M^n+ =Na^+, Mg^2+, Ca^2+, Sr^2+, Ba^2+, Zn^2+, Cu^2+, Cd^2+, Mn^2+ 와 Pb^2+)], a toluene membrane containing of the macrocyclic ligand[acryloyl methyl benzo-18-crown-6 and poly(acryloyl methyl benzo-18-crown-6)] and the surfactant Span 80, and an aqueous Li_4P_2O_7 receiving phase. In the experiment for metal ions transport using this emulsioning liquid membrane, the Pb^2+ ion transport was more higher than other metal ions.
백서에서 진통과 금단증상에 미치는 Enkephalinase Inhibitor의 영향
곽기철,조문환,김기원,채수완,조규박 의과학연구소 1991 全北醫大論文集 Vol.15 No.3
Analgesic effect and influence of 2 enkephalinase inhibitors, thiorphan and N-carboxyl-Phe Leu(CMPL) on the analgesia induced by centrally administered Leu-enkephalin, B-endorphin or morphine, and their influences on the withdrawal signs in chronic morphine-dependent rats were examined. Intracerebroventricular administration of thiorphan and CMPL induced short-lasting analgesia in a dose dependent manner, whereas CMPL was 3.5 time more potent than phiorphan. these analgesic effects were attrnuated by preteatment with naloxone. Subanalgesic doses of yhese inhibitors significantly enhanced the analgesic effect of :eu-enkephalin or B-endorphine However, neither of these inhibitors affecyed the analgrsic effect morphine. In chronic morphine-dependent rats, intraventricular thiorphan or CMPL significantly attenuated naxone-precipitated jumping, diarrhea, ptosis and teeth chattering, while wet-dog shaking sign was unaltered and penile licking sign was increased. These results showed that enkephalinase inhibitors can produce analgesia by themselves and that they can enchance the analgesic effects of ensogenous opioids. these data also suggest that enkephalinase inhibitors might be useful in attenuating opiate withdrawal symptoms.
